‘The Rookie’ Season 4 Episode 13 Photos, Plot, Cast and Air Date

A teenager takes over a police helicopter and puts the officers on high alert on ABC’s The Rookie season four episode 13. Directed by Lanre Olabisi from a script by Brynn Malone, episode 13 – “Fight or Flight” – will air on Sunday, January 30, 2022 at 10pm ET/PT.

Season four stars Nathan Fillion as John Nolan, Mekia Cox as Nyla Harper, Alyssa Diaz as Angela Lopez, and Richard T. Jones as Wade Grey. Melissa O’Neil is Lucy Chen and Eric Winter stars as Tim Bradford.

Guest stars include Tru Valentino as Aaron Thorson, Arjay Smith as James Murray, and Jay Hunter as Officer Gil Webb.

“Fight or Flight” Plot: Officers John Nolan and Lucy Chen must fulfill three quests if they want to get a stolen police helicopter back safely from a teenage thief. Meanwhile, Officer Nyla Harper and Aaron Thorson must guard a convicted cop killer in the hospital following a prison riot.

Guillermo del Toro’s ‘Pinocchio’ Teaser Features the Voice of Ewan McGregor

Emmy Award winner Ewan McGregor (Halston) lends his voice to Sebastian J. Cricket in Guillermo del Toro’s much-anticipated, long-awaited stop-motion animated musical Pinocchio. In the official teaser for the 2022 film, McGregor’s Cricket claims that because he actually lived in the heart of the wooden marionette, he actually knows the full story of the wooden toy who transformed into a real boy. What’s not revealed is whether this Cricket’s middle initial stands for Jiminy, although it’s not a stretch to assume that’s the case.

The one-minute teaser is, as expected from a Guillermo del Toro production, visually stunning.

Oscar-winner del Toro and Mark Gustafson directed from a screenplay by del Toro and Patrick McHale. Producers include del Toro, Jim Henson Company’s Lisa Henson, Alex Bulkley, Shadow Machine’s Corey Campodonico, and Gary Ungar. Jason Lust serves as an executive producer.

In addition to Ewan McGregor, the voice cast includes David Bradley as Geppetto, Gregory Mann as Pinocchio, Finn Wolfhard, Oscar winner Cate Blanchett, John Turturro, Ron Perlman, Tim Blake Nelson, Burn Gorman, Oscar winner Christoph Waltz, and Oscar winner Tilda Swinton.

“After years of pursuing this dream project, I found my perfect partner in Netflix. We have spent a long time curating a remarkable cast and crew and have been blessed by continuous support from Netflix to quietly and carefully soldier on, barely missing a beat. We all love and practice animation with great passion and believe it to be the ideal medium to retell this classic story in a completely new way,” said Guillermo del Toro in an August 2020 statement on the status of the film.

Netflix is targeting a November 2022 premiere.

The Plot:

Academy Award-winning filmmaker Guillermo del Toro reinvents Carlo Collodi’s classic tale of the wooden marionette who is magically brought to life in order to mend the heart of a grieving woodcarver named Geppetto. This whimsical, stop-motion musical directed by Guillermo del Toro and Mark Gustafson follows the mischievous and disobedient adventures of Pinocchio in his pursuit of a place in the world.

Michelle Buteau Comedy Series Greenlit at Netflix

Survival of the Thickest

Michelle Buteau’s got a packed 2022 schedule, with Netflix just greenlighting the Survival of the Thickest scripted comedy series based on her popular book of essays. Buteau also hosts the streaming service’s The Circle competition series and she’ll soon be seen starring with Jennifer Lopez and Owen Wilson in the romantic comedy Marry Me.

“It’s been so damn amazing finding a home with Netflix,” said Buteau. “To say I’m excited to continue my relationship with them is an understatement. I’m over the moon and I’m under it! Danielle has been a dream partner and I can’t wait to share what we’ve been cooking up.”

Netflix released the following synopsis of Survival of the Thickest:

Survival of the Thickest centers on Mavis Beaumont (Buteau). Black, plus-size and newly single, Mavis Beaumont unexpectedly finds herself having to rebuild her life after putting all her eggs in one man’s basket, but she’s determined to not only survive but thrive with the support of her chosen family, a positive attitude, and a cute v-neck with some lip gloss.”

Netflix gave the comedy from Buteau and Danielle Sanchez-Witzel an eight-episode order. Buteau stars and Sanchez-Witzel will serve as the showrunner, with Ravi Nandan and Alli Reich on board as executive producers.

“Michelle Buteau is many things: a brilliant writer, a gifted stand-up comedian and an empowering performer,” stated Tracey Pakosta, Head of Comedy at Netflix. “But above all else: she is one of the funniest people alive. Paired with Danielle Sanchez-Witzel – one of TV’s sharpest visionaries – Survival of the Thickest will bring Michelle’s unique point of view to life.”

Michelle Buteau’s additional credits include Michelle Buteau: Welcome to Buteaupia, The Principles of Pleasure, Always Be My Maybe, and Tales of the City.




Far from “Ordinary” – Natalie Martinez Talks About Her Career and ‘Ordinary Joe’

Ordinary Joe Season 1
Natalie Martinez as Amy Kindelán and James Wolk as Joe Kimbreau in ‘Ordinary Joe’ season 1 (Photo by: Fernando Decillis/NBC)

Actress Natalie Martinez is very selective about her roles.

“I think it depends on the character, what she’s going through, what the script’s about, what the story tells – it’s a lot of little things. I’m not gonna lie: Sometimes, the location’s very enticing,” said Martinez, of Los Angeles, laughing. “The majority of the time, if I read a script and it’s something I really connect with, it’s basically all I need.”

Best known for her roles on Detroit 1-8-7, Under the Dome, CSI:NY, The Stand, and Secrets and Lies, Martinez currently portrays Amy on NBC’s Ordinary Joe, the first season of which concludes on January 24, 2022.

“I just loved the idea and the concept of the show that you have them living these parallel lives,” explained Martinez. “I think that’s a question we always ask ourselves – the what-ifs. As an actress, it’s such a meaty part where I get to play essentially the same character but in three different worlds, molded by her experiences and things that had happened to her in each of those lives. We’re all really defined by our experiences and what we go through. I thought it was amazing to be able to do a job like this; it’s not something you see very often, so that really attracted me to it.”

Parallel Lives

On Ordinary Joe, the show’s focal point is Joe Kimbreau (James Wolk, Mad Men, The Crazy Ones). On the day he graduates from Syracuse University, Joe must choose with whom to celebrate: his family; Jenny (Elizabeth Lail, You), his on-again/off-again girlfriend; or Amy, whom he just met at graduation.

The story picks up 10 years later, splitting into three separate timelines. If Joe goes with his family, he becomes a cop like his father who died in the 9/11 attacks. His uncle Frank (David Warshofsky, The Mentalist), a veteran detective, mentors him. Amy eventually becomes his love interest in this reality.

If Joe goes with Jenny, he learns she’s pregnant and becomes a nurse. They get married and raise their son Christopher (newcomer John Gluck), who has muscular dystrophy. In this reality, Amy is married to Joe’s BFF, Eric Payne (Charlie Barnett, Chicago Fire).

If Joe goes with Amy, he becomes a famous rock star, while Amy becomes chief of staff for Congressman Bobby Diaz (Adam Rodriguez, Criminal Minds). Amy suffers multiple miscarriages and decides to focus on her career. This upsets Joe, who wants children. That’s compounded when he learns he got Jenny pregnant, and she gave their son up for adoption. They eventually connect with their son, who’s named Zeke in this reality.

What’s more, Amy cheats on Joe with Bobby, believing Joe is having an affair with Jenny. Bobby is later assassinated at a rally. Amy confesses about her affair with Bobby and is pregnant with Bobby’s child. Hurt and angry, Joe wants to leave Amy and goes down a self-destructive path, drinking and philandering.

“Human beings are curious, y’know? We take so many turns in our lives, we always wonder, ‘What if I didn’t?’ That’s really entertaining and it’s fun to put yourself in those worlds. What’s really cool about our show is that you actually see all the three worlds, all the parallel worlds being lived out, which is something you normally don’t see,” said Martinez. “It’s not something like, ‘Oh, I wonder if Joe’ll become a musician?’ You get to see that world and another choice and (yet) another choice as well. That’s what makes (our show) really interesting.”

Of all the incarnations of Amy she likes playing the most, Martinez prefers the Amy in music world.

“I love them all – I love them all for different reasons,” she said. “I would have to say, as an actress, I love music world because there’s so much going on – there’s so much drama, there’s so much in the relationship, she’s battling so many things as well. I love the cop world because it’s fun and flirty and young love… I would have to say music world is my favorite.”

Mutual Admiration Society

According to Martinez, the Ordinary Joe set is a happy one, filled with plenty of laughter, despite the heavy topics being tackled. There are no complaints whatsoever.

“I really, really enjoyed working with everybody from top to bottom. It’s a really great set. It’s a fun job. I look forward to going to work. I love working with everybody… Everyone loves being there, loves what we do, loves what we’re doing with the show,” she said.

Martinez spoke about working with Elizabeth Lail.

“She’s a sweetheart – she’s so sweet, so caring. I love the scenes where we all get to be together,” said Martinez. “It’s funny because when she’s with Joe, I have this little jealousy thing going on… It’s a funny dynamic because in one scene, she’s married to him and in the next scene, I’m married to him. It makes for good jokes on set.”

She enjoys working with James Wolk as well.

“James is a sweetheart. He’s so nice and has such a good attitude… I really enjoy working with James. We have a lot of fun. We laugh pretty much half the time. On Episode 12, James and I in cop world were sitting down at the dinner table and talking to each other. When I saw that scene on-air, I thought, ‘Wow, that actually turned out pretty well’ because we could not stop laughing the entire time! The editors did a really great job on that one.”

In turn, Wolk praised Martinez.

“She’s so much fun. We laugh constantly,” he said. “That’s a big theme on our set; even though the show has heavy content, there’s a ton of humor behind the scenes. She’s great. She’s really fun to work with and is really talented.”

Death Race

Born in Florida, Martinez, who is of Cuban descent, is a graduate of St. Brendan High School, a Catholic school in Miami. Martinez began modeling at 15. During her senior year, she beat more than 5,000 girls to be the model for J. Lo’s new clothing line.

Martinez made the transition from modeling to acting. Her first role was on the telenovela Fashion House in 2006. She portrayed Michelle Miller in the nighttime soap opera that was canceled after three months.

In 2008, Martinez made her feature film debut in Death Race (a remake of 1975’s Death Race 2000, which starred a pre-Rocky Sylvester Stallone), a dystopian action movie. A sadistic warden controls the Death Race, where prison inmates battle each other in specially modified racing cars with the ultimate goal of winning their freedom. The movie featured Jason Statham (The Expendables), Ian McShane (Deadwood), and Oscar nominee Joan Allen (The Contender).

As for how she got the part of Case, Martinez stated she simply auditioned.

“It was a crazy audition: I was sitting on a chair, pretending I was in this race car. That was awkward but fun,” she recalled. “I booked a movie with great co-stars. It definitely was a big milestone in my life, the fact I’m in a movie of that stature. I had a great time. I learned a lot. It was fun to shoot. Jason Statham’s great. I got to work with Ian McShane, who I’ve been a fan of for a very long time. We always had such a positive vibe on set. It was my first movie, so it’s something that’ll always be with me.”

Detroit 1-8-7

Her next major role was Det. Ariana Sanchez on 2010-11’s Detroit 1-8-7, which aired for one season on ABC. This was the first TV series that was set in and filmed in Detroit.

“I loved how strong she was. That’s what draws me to a lot of characters; I really like playing strong women,” said Martinez. “It was my first real network TV show. I was just on a high. I’m actually still friends with everybody on there… We still talk all the time… We really made some great friendships on that show.”

Martinez has fond memories of working in Detroit.

“I loved it. I actually loved Detroit. I had such a great time there – the food, the people,” recalled Martinez.

After 1-8-7, Martinez played Deputy Linda Esquivel on 2013-14’s Under the Dome. This CBS series was based on Stephen King’s bestselling novel of the same name. It also reunited Martinez with her 1-8-7 co-star Aisha Hinds.

“Natalie’s so much fun. She goes into these cities we visit. She absorbs the entire city and gets to the heart of the city; it’s great to take that journey with her,” said Hinds. “It’s wonderful to experience life with her and also to work with her… (she) makes lifetime friends. I love working with her.”

Dome was not Martinez’s first time in a King adaptation. In 2020, she co-starred on CBS’ The Stand, which is based on King’s 1978 novel of the same name – and one of his best-known novels. This is the second time The Stand was adapted into a mini-series, the first time being in 1994.

“I’m a huge fan of (King),” said Martinez. “I got to meet him when I was doing (Dome). He’s just great. It’s also iconic, especially when you get something from Stephen King – it’s something we all grew up with, whether you read him or not.”

What’s Next

NBC has not yet been announced if Ordinary Joe will be returning for a second season.

“I really hope it gets picked up again,” said Martinez.

Regardless, Martinez is keeping busy. She is producing several projects, which are currently in the development stages.

“I love creating. I love working. Sometimes when you don’t see something out there that you want to see, you make it. That’s what got me into it. I come from an interesting background and have so many stories that I’d love to tell; you just gotta get out there and produce your own work,” she said.

Eventually, Martinez would like to branch out into directing.

“At some point, for sure,” she said. “That’s definitely a goal of mine.”




‘Magnum P.I.’ Season 4 Episode 13 Preview: Photos, Plot, and Cast

Magnum and Higgins team up to help out a judge on CBS’s Magnum P.I. season four episode 13. Directed by Benny Boom from a script by David Slack, episode 13 – “Judge Me Not” – will air on Friday, January 28, 2022 at 9pm ET/PT.

Jay Hernandez returns to lead the cast as Thomas Magnum. Season four also stars Perdita Weeks as Juliet Higgins, Zachary Knighton as Orville “Rick” Wright, Stephen Hill as Theodore “TC” Calvin, Tim Kang as Det. Gordon Katsumoto, and Amy Hill as Kumu.

Guest stars include Moon Bloodgood, Maya Stojan, Nicole Pierce, and Justin Martin.

“Judge Me Not” Plot: When Hawaii Supreme Court nominee Judge Rachel Park (Bloodgood) is being blackmailed, she hires Magnum and Higgins who go to extraordinary lengths to help her out. Also, with the pressure of fatherhood looming, Rick suggests changes to make La Mariana more profitable, but TC and Kumo aren’t swayed.

Magnum P.I. Description, Courtesy of CBS:

Magnum P.I. is a modern take on the classic series centering on Thomas Magnum, a decorated former Navy SEAL who, upon returning home from Afghanistan, repurposes his military skills to become a private investigator. A charming rogue, an American hero and a die-hard Detroit Tigers fan, Magnum lives in a guest cottage on Robin’s Nest, the luxurious estate where he works as a security consultant to supplement his P.I. business.

The “majordomo” of the property is Juliet Higgins, a beautiful and commanding disavowed MI:6 agent whose second job is to keep Magnum in line, with the help of her two Dobermans. When Magnum needs back-up on a job, he turns to his trusted buddies and fellow POW survivors, Theodore “TC” Calvin, a former Marine chopper pilot who runs Island Hoppers, a helicopter tour business, and Orville “Rick” Wright, a former Marine door-gunner-turned-impresario of Oahu’s coolest nightclub and the most connected man on the island.

Suspicious of Magnum’s casual attitude and presence at his crime scenes, Detective Gordon Katsumoto finds that he and Magnum are more alike than either of them care to admit. One of Magnum’s biggest supporters is Teuila “Kumu” Tuileta, the unofficial “House Mom” and cultural curator of Robin’s Nest. With keys to a vintage Ferrari in one hand, aviator sunglasses in the other, and an Old Düsseldorf longneck chilling in the fridge, Thomas Magnum is back on the case!

‘Blue Bloods’ Season 12 Episode 13 Photos, Plot, and Cast

Blue Bloods Season 12 Episode 13
Tom Selleck as Frank Reagan and Donnie Wahlberg as Danny Reagan in ‘Blue Bloods’ season 13 episode 13 ( Photo by John Paul Filo. © 2021 CBS Broadcasting Inc)

CBS’s Blue Bloods season 12 episode 13 finds the Reagans investigating a dirty cop. Directed by Alex Zakrzewski from a script by Kevin Riley, episode 13 is set to air on Friday, January 28, 2022 at 10pm ET/PT.

Tom Selleck leads the cast as Frank Reagan, with Donnie Wahlberg back as Danny Reagan and Bridget Moynahan returning as Erin Reagan. Will Estes plays Jamie Reagan, Len Cariou is Henry Reagan, Sami Gayle is Nicky Reagan-Boyle, Marisa Ramirez is Det. Maria Baez, and Vanessa Ray plays Officer Eddie Janko.

Recurring season 12 cast members include Abigail Hawk, Gregory Jbara, Robert Clohessy, Steven Schirripa, and Andrew Terraciano.

Cold Comfort” Plot: Frank contends with a potentially dirty cop within his ranks when Danny and Baez’s investigation into a brutal assault on an NYPD detective reveals the officer may be corrupt. Also, Eddie and Badillo track down the culprits behind the theft of valuable rare works from a celebrated bookstore; Jamie begrudgingly joins Henry as he looks into an old friend’s death he deems suspicious; and Erin snoops into the background of a new woman in Anthony’s life.

Series Description, Courtesy of CBS:

Blue Bloods is a drama about a multi-generational family of cops dedicated to New York City law enforcement. Frank Reagan is the New York Police Commissioner, and heads both the police force and the Reagan brood. He runs his department as diplomatically as he runs his family, even when dealing with the politics that plagued his unapologetically bold father, Henry, during his stint as Chief. A source of pride and concern for Frank is his eldest son, Danny, a seasoned detective, family man and Iraq War vet who on occasion uses dubious tactics to solve cases with his partner, Detective Maria Baez. Erin, the middle daughter, is a New York Assistant D.A. who serves as the legal compass for her siblings and father.

Jamie is the youngest Reagan, a Harvard Law graduate and the family’s “golden boy.” Unable to deny the family tradition, Jamie decided to give up a lucrative future in law and follow in the family footsteps as a cop. He’s found a friend and ally in his wife, Eddie, who keeps him on his toes, and has very different reasons than the Reagans for joining the police force.

‘Star Trek: Picard’ Season 2 Trailer Welcomes Back Whoopi Goldberg

The official trailer for season two of Paramount+’s Star Trek: Picard finds special guest star Whoopi Goldberg’s Guinan greeted with a warm hug by Patrick Stewart’s Jean-Luc Picard. “Your answers are not in the stars…and they never have been,” explains Guinan.

The season two cast also includes Alison Pill, Jeri Ryan, Michelle Hurd, Evan Evagora, Orla Brady, Isa Briones, Santiago Cabrera, Brent Spiner, and Annie Wersching. John de Lancie is also on board as a special guest star.

Akiva Goldsman and Terry Matalas are the co-showrunners and serve as executive producers along with Patrick Stewart, Alex Kurtzman, Heather Kadin, Aaron Baiers, Rod Roddenberry, Trevor Roth, Doug Aarniokoski, and Dylan Massin. Star Trek: Picard is produced by CBS Studios in association with Secret Hideout and Roddenberry Entertainment.

Season two will premiere on March 3, 2022. New episodes of the 10-episode season will arrive on subsequent Thursdays.

The third season of the popular sci-fi series is currently in production.

Star Trek Picard Season 2
Whoopi Goldberg as Guinan and Sir Patrick Stewart as Jean-Luc Picard in the Paramount+ original series ‘STAR TREK: PICARD’ (Photo Cr: Nicole Wilder / Paramount+ ©2022 ViacomCBS)

The Plot, Courtesy of Paramount+:

Star Trek: Picard features Patrick Stewart reprising his iconic role as Jean-Luc Picard, which he played for seven seasons on Star Trek: The Next Generation, and follows this iconic character into the next chapter of his life.

Season two of Star Trek: Picard takes the legendary Jean-Luc Picard and his crew on a bold and exciting new journey: into the past. Picard must enlist friends both old and new to confront the perils of 21st century Earth in a desperate race against time to save the galaxy’s future – and face the ultimate trial from one of his greatest foes.




‘SWAT’ Season 5 Episode 11 Photos, Plot, and New Air Date

CBS switched up their primetime schedule a bit, moving S.W.A.T. season five episode 11 off of its January 23, 2022 air date and opting instead to air NCIS: Hawai’i’s two-parter on January 23 & 24. S.W.A.T.‘s season five episode 11 will premiere on Sunday, February 27, 2022 at 10pm ET/PT.

The season five cast is led by Shemar Moore as Daniel “Hondo” Harrelson. Alex Russell stars as Jim Street, Jay Harrington plays David “Deacon” Kay, Lina Esco is Christina “Chris” Alonso, Kenny Johnson is Dominique Luca, David Lim is Victor Tan, and Patrick St. Esprit stars as Commander Robert Hicks.

“Old School Cool” Plot: Hondo and the team race to locate the hacker responsible for accessing LAPD’s computers and revealing the identities of undercover officers before the leaked intelligence has fatal consequences. Also, Street is forced to reckon with past misdeeds.

Series Description, Courtesy of CBS:

Inspired by the television series and the feature film, S.W.A.T. stars Shemar Moore as a former Marine and locally born and raised S.W.A.T. sergeant, tasked to run a specialized tactical unit that is the last stop in law enforcement in Los Angeles. Torn between loyalty to where he was raised and allegiance to his brothers in blue, Daniel “Hondo” Harrelson strives to bridge the divide between his two worlds. However, Hondo is forced to question his professional identity when he is demoted from Squad Leader after going public to expose racial corruption within the LAPD.

The other members of Hondo’s elite S.W.A.T. unit include David “Deacon” Kay, an experienced S.W.A.T. officer and dedicated family man who always puts the team first; Christina “Chris” Alonso, a skilled officer and the team’s canine trainer; Dominique Luca, an expert driver who gets them in and out of high risk situations; newlywed Victor Tan, who started in the LAPD Hollywood Division and uses his confidential informants in the community to help the team; and Jim Street, the team’s cocky newest member. Responsible for the management of all Metro Division S.W.A.T. units is Commander Robert Hicks, a senior LAPD official with the Special Operations Bureau.

With Hondo no longer leading the charge, these dedicated men and women face an uncertain future as they bravely put themselves at risk to protect their community and save lives.

‘The Rookie’ Season 4 Episode 12 Photos, Plot, and Cast Info

The teaser video for ABC’s The Rookie season four episode 12 features a severed arm moving on its own, an awkward double date, and a weirdly cheerful Nyla. Directed by Charissa Sanjarernsuithikul from a script by Zoe Cheng, season four episode 12 will air on Sunday, January 23, 2022 at 10pm ET/PT.

Season four stars Nathan Fillion as John Nolan, Mekia Cox as Nyla Harper, Alyssa Diaz as Angela Lopez, and Richard T. Jones as Wade Grey. Melissa O’Neil is Lucy Chen and Eric Winter stars as Tim Bradford.

Guest stars include Brent Huff as Officer Smitty, Crystal Coney as Nurse Lisa, Helena Mattsson as Ashley McGrady, Kanoa Goo as ADA Chris Sanford, and Jay Hunter as Officer Gil Webb.

“The Knock” Plot: The team responds to the report of a severed hand washing up on the beach and are on the hunt to find its owner. Meanwhile, Tim attempts to prove he isn’t a control freak to Lucy and invites her on a double date with him and Ashley.

‘One Tree Hill’ Cast Reunites on ‘Good Sam’

Good Sam
Bethany Joy Lenz, Sophia Bush, and Hilarie Burton reunite on ‘Good Sam’ (Photo: Courtesy of Danielle Blancher)

One Tree Hill stars Bethany Joy Lenz, Hilarie Burton, and Sophia Bush have reunited for an upcoming episode of Bush’s new CBS medical drama, Good Sam. The season one episode started filming today and will air later this season.

CBS released the following description of the characters Bethany Joy Lenz and Hilarie Burton are playing: “On Good Sam, Burton and Lenz will play sisters, Gretchen and Amy Taylor, respectively, who cross paths with Dr. Sam Griffith (Bush) when Amy is admitted as a patient at Detroit’s Lakeshore Sentinel Hospital.”

Bush, Lenz, and Burton have remained close friends and even co-host an iHeartRadio podcast titled “Drama Queens.” The podcast features the trio discussing their time spent working on One Tree Hill which ran on The CW from 2003 through 2012.

Good Sam premiered on January 5, 2022 and stars Sophia Bush as Dr. Sam Griffith and Jason Isaacs as her dad, Dr. Rob “Griff” Griffith. The season one cast also includes Skye P. Marshall as Dr. Lex Trulie, Michael Stahl-David as Dr. Caleb Tucker, Omar Maskati as Dr. Isan M. Shah, Davi Santos as Dr. Joey Costa, Wendy Crewson as Vivian Katz, and Edwin Hodge as Malcolm A. Kingsley.

Good Sam airs on Wednesdays at 10pm ET/PT.

The Plot, Courtesy of CBS:

“Good Sam stars Sophia Bush and Jason Isaacs in a drama about Dr. Sam Griffith, a gifted heart surgeon who excels in her new leadership role as chief of surgery after her renowned boss falls into a coma. When her former boss wakes up months later demanding to resume his duties, Sam is tasked with supervising this egotistical expert with a scalpel who never acknowledged her stellar talent.

Complicating matters, the caustic and arrogant Dr. Rob ‘Griff’ Griffith also happens to be her father. As Griff defies Sam’s authority and challenges her medical expertise, the big question becomes whether this father and daughter will ever be able to mend their own relationship as expertly as they heal the hearts of their patients.”
